Among nursing homes in Wisconsin, Kewaunee Health Services stands out with an A grade and a score of 92 out of 100. It ranks in the 92th percentile statewide, reflecting consistently high performance across CMS quality metrics.
Staffing at Kewaunee Health Services is near the national average, with 3.75 total nursing hours per resident per day (national average: 3.8 hours).
Recent inspections identified 8 deficiencies at Kewaunee Health Services.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

How This Grade Was Calculated
This facility's grade of A is based on a score of 92 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:
- Overall CMS Rating: 5★ → 40 pts (max 40)
- Health Inspection Rating: 5★ → 25 pts (max 25)
- Staffing Rating: 3★ → 12 pts (max 20)
- Quality Measures Rating: 5★ → 15 pts (max 15)
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
